Having Difficulty Breathing? Here are 7 Foods to Keep Your Lungs Healthy that You Need to Know

Kapanlagi.com - Shortness of breath is one of the most common respiratory disorders experienced by many people. Suddenly feeling short of breath can be caused by various factors, such as lung health problems. Therefore, it is very important to maintain lung health. One way to do this is by consuming foods that maintain lung health.

The lungs are indeed one of the vital organs that need to be maintained. Like other body organs, the lungs also need nutritional intake to stay healthy. Several types of foods are believed to have the necessary nutrients for the lungs. So, what are some of these foods?

Compiled from various sources, here are several types of foods that maintain lung health.

 

1. Salmon

Salmon is known as one of the types of fish that is rich in nutrients, making it very healthy. It's no wonder that salmon is considered expensive in the market. One of the benefits of salmon is that it can maintain lung health.

This is because salmon contains the nutrients needed by the lungs, such as omega-3 fatty acids and vitamin D. According to eatingwell.com, omega-3 fatty acids in the body are useful for preventing inflammation, including in the lungs. Meanwhile, vitamin D is useful for improving respiratory muscle strength.

2. Oysters

In addition to salmon, oysters are also one of the types of food ingredients that are beneficial for lung health. Oysters contain various nutrients for the lungs, such as zinc, selenium, vitamin B, and copper. According to healthline.com, a study revealed that selenium and copper levels can improve lung function.

Meanwhile, not many people know that vitamin B, especially B12, is actually beneficial for smokers. This is because vitamin B12 can help reduce the risk of chronic obstructive pulmonary disease.

3. Turmeric

In Indonesia, turmeric is known as one type of spice or seasoning that is also often used as a traditional medicine. Turmeric is famous for its high antioxidant content and anti-inflammatory properties. The antioxidant substance called curcumin in turmeric is believed to provide many benefits, including maintaining lung health.

Curcumin is believed to improve lung function. Especially for active smokers, curcumin reduces the risk of lung damage.

4. Apple

Apple is one of the most popular fruits. Besides its sweet and refreshing taste, apples are also known as beneficial fruits. One of the benefits of apples is that they can improve lung function. The content in apples is believed to enhance a person's lung function.

Regular consumption of apples is not only believed to maintain stable lung function, but also reduce the risk of lung-related diseases, such as cancer. This is because apples are rich in antioxidants such as flavonoids and vitamin C.

5. Green Tea

Besides being delicious, green tea is also known for its extraordinary benefits for the body's health. The benefits of green tea for health are caused by the presence of antioxidants and anti-inflammatory properties.

According to healthline.com, antioxidants and anti-inflammatory properties in green tea are useful in preventing fibrosis. Fibrosis is a disease that affects lung function. This disease is characterized by the appearance of progressive scar tissue. In fact, not only preventing, antioxidants and anti-inflammatory properties in green tea are also useful for treating fibrosis.

6. Yogurt

Yogurt is one of the dairy products that is well-known for its health benefits. However, yogurt is not only known for its good effects on digestion, but also as one of the foods that can maintain lung health.

Yogurt contains several nutrients that are needed by the lungs such as calcium, potassium, phosphorus, and selenium. With these nutritional contents, lung function will be maintained. In addition, a person can also be more protected from the risk of chronic obstructive pulmonary disease.

7. Tomatoes

Tomatoes contain a high amount of lycopene, as well as an antioxidant called carotenoid. These nutritional contents are also useful for maintaining and improving lung health. Consuming tomatoes regularly is believed to reduce inflammation in the respiratory tract.

This is especially beneficial for asthma patients. Additionally, it is also very beneficial for maintaining and improving lung function in active smokers who have quit smoking.

Those are a series of foods that maintain lung health. You can maintain lung health and smooth respiratory system by consuming the foods mentioned above. However, don't forget to exercise regularly and adopt a healthy lifestyle.
